Output 44f1fc082c2eeafa3736791d256a2dff6ba9fc93abd8fabc00df30cac7e40a90:6

value
81890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75a7f21d6a68ecb69eb3db63d141f50ac5120bd OP_EQUAL
address
3MKhcbsNCX7nfcRkum4qP81R2u5mgTpdP3
transaction
44f1fc082c2eeafa3736791d256a2dff6ba9fc93abd8fabc00df30cac7e40a90
confirmations
242137
spent
true